________ and ________ are the hallmarks of the experimental method, which set it apart from the observational and correlational methods

a. Random assignment; probability levels
b. Representative sampling; control over extraneous variables
c. Control over extraneous variables; random assignment
d. Correlation coefficients; dependent variables


Answer: C
